Transaction fc8600074ba8107a6d7a8ce5b8d031cc6c3213d75fd71ef935cb94c6f3723c03

1 Input
1 Outputs
  • fc8600074ba8107a6d7a8ce5b8d031cc6c3213d75fd71ef935cb94c6f3723c03:0
  • value  499995111
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G